Description:

Polyvinylpyrrolidone, abbreviated as PVP, is a polymer of vinylpyrrolidone. Due to its different degrees of polymerization, it is divided into soluble PVP and insoluble PVPP (polyvinylpyrrolidone). The relative molecular weight of soluble PVP is 8000-10000, which can be used as a precipitant to precipitate when it interacts with polyphenolic substances. Using this method, residual PVP is prone to remain in the wine. Due to the accumulation effect of PVP in the human body, the World Health Organization does not recommend its use. In recent years, the use of soluble PVP has become rare. Insoluble PVPP series began to be used in the beer industry in the early 1960s, with a relative mass greater than 700000. It is a high molecular weight insoluble substance formed by further crosslinking and polymerization of PVP, and can be used as an adsorbent for polyphenolic substances with good results.

 

Applications:

Clarifying agent; Pigment stabilizer; Colloidal stabilizer. Mainly used for clarification and quality stability of beer(reference dosage 8-20g/100L, maintained for
24 hours and filtered out).It can also be used in combination with enzymes (proteases) and protein adsorbents. Also used as a stabilizer for clarifying wine
and preventing discoloration (reference dosage 24-72g/100L).
Clarifying agent; Stabilizer; Thickener; Tablet filling agent; dispersant. Polymer PVP with a molecular weight of 360000 is commonly used as a clarifying agent for beer,
vinegar, wine, and other beverages.
Used as a stationary liquid for gas chromatography
Widely used as a thickener, emulsifier, lubricant, and clarifier, as well as a complex of disinfectant PVP-I
As a colloid stabilizer and clarifying agent, it can be used for clarifying beer and used in moderation according to production needs.
Medical, aquaculture, and livestock disinfectants. Used for disinfection of skin and mucous membranes.
PolyFilterTM molecules have amide bonds and adsorb hydroxyl groups on polyphenol molecules to form hydrogen bonds. Therefore, they can be used as stabilizers for beer,
fruit wine/grape wine, and beverage wine, extending their shelf life and improving their transparency, color, and taste in Chemicalbook. This product comes
in two specifications: disposable and reusable. Disposable products are suitable for use by small and medium-sized enterprises; Regenerative products require the purchase
of specialized filtration equipment, but they are recyclable and suitable for large-scale breweries to recycle
In daily cosmetics, PVP and copolymers have good dispersibility and film forming property, and can be used as setting liquid, setting agent of hair spray and mousse,
shading agent of hair conditioner, foam stabilizer of shampoo, wave setting agent, dispersant and affinity agent of hair dye. Adding PVP to Snow Chemicalbook Flower Cream,
Sunscreen, and Hair Removal Agent can enhance moisturizing and lubricating effects. The excellent surface activity, film-forming properties, and non irritating
and non allergic reactions of PVP have broad prospects for application in hair care products, skincare products, and other fields.
Used for absorbing phenols and tannic acid from water extracts to purify plant enzymes. Used as a chromatographic adsorbent to separate aromatic acids, aldehydes,
and phenols. Used for clarifying beer and wine.
